Wood shingle roof replacement involves removing the existing roofing material and installing new wood shingles to restore or improve the roof’s appearance and functionality. This process typically starts with a thorough inspection to assess the condition of the current roof, followed by careful removal of damaged or aging shingles. The new wood shingles are then precisely installed to ensure durability, weather resistance, and an attractive, natural look that can enhance the overall curb appeal of the property. Skilled contractors use proper techniques to ensure the roof is properly ventilated and sealed, helping to extend its lifespan and protect the underlying structure.
This service addresses a range of common problems that can develop over time with wood shingle roofs. These include rot, warping, or splitting caused by ex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ations. Moss, algae, or mold growth can also compromise the shingles’ integrity and appearance. Additionally, older roofs may develop leaks or become less effective at shedding water, leading to potential interior damage. Replacing the roof with new wood shingles can help solve these issues, providing a fresh, protective covering that maintains the aesthetic appeal of traditional wood roofing while offering improved performance.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shingle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wayne,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ood shingle roof repairs in Wayne, NJ, range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, especially for localized damage or replacing a few shingles. Larger, more involved repairs can occasionally reach higher prices but are less common.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of a wood shingle roof usually costs between $1,200-$3,500, depending on the size and complexity of the area. Most projects in this range are straightforward, with fewer jobs exceeding $4,000.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a wood shingle roof generally falls between $7,000-$15,000 for typical homes in Wayne, NJ. Many full replacements are in the middle of this range, while larger or more complex projects can go higher.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ate roof replacements or jobs involving additional repairs can exceed $20,000. These projects are less frequent and often involve extensive work or unique architectural features requiring specialized craftsmanship.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my wood shingle roof needs replacement? Signs such as extensive rotting, cracked or missing shingles, and widespread moss or mold growth indicate that a roof replacement may be necessary.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for wood shingle roof replacement? It’s important to select local contractors with experience in roof replacements, good reputation, and proper insurance to ensure quality work and reliable service.
Are there different styles or types of wood shingles available for replacement? Yes, various styles and types of wood shingles, including cedar and redwood, are available to match the aesthetic and functional needs of different homes.
What steps are involved in the wood shingle roof replacement process? The process typically includes removing the old shingles, inspecting the roof deck, and installing new, properly fitted wood shingles to ensure durability and appearance.
